Canada's CARM System 2026: E-commerce Compliance Guide
Prepare for Canada's CARM System 2026. This guide details essential compliance steps for cross-border e-commerce, from HS codes to financial security, minimizing duty risks by 30%.
Canada's CARM (CBSA Assessment and Revenue Management) system, fully implemented by 2026, fundamentally shifts how non-resident importers and e-commerce businesses manage customs duties and taxes, requiring proactive registration and financial security to avoid significant delays and penalties.
The $1.3 Billion Customs Modernization: Why CARM 2026 Matters for Your E-commerce
In 2023 alone, Canadian consumers spent over $40.5 billion on e-commerce, with a significant portion flowing from cross-border transactions. Yet, as we approach 2026, many non-resident e-commerce importers remain dangerously unprepared for the full impact of Canada's CARM (CBSA Assessment and Revenue Management) system, a $1.3 billion modernization initiative. Our analysis shows that a staggering 45% of cross-border e-commerce businesses currently importing into Canada lack a clear strategy for CARM Release 2 compliance, risking severe operational disruptions and financial penalties.
CARM isn't just an IT upgrade; it's a fundamental restructuring of how the Canada Border Services Agency (CBSA) assesses, collects, and manages import duties and taxes. For e-commerce retailers, this means a pivotal shift from relying solely on customs brokers for financial liability to a direct, self-serve accountability model. Ignoring this evolution could result in shipment delays, increased landed costs, and administrative fines that erode profit margins by 10-15%. This guide cuts through the noise, providing a precise, actionable roadmap for compliance with CARM 2026.
💡 Expert Tip: Begin CARM Client Portal registration immediately, even if your import volumes are modest. Procrastination risks processing backlogs, potentially delaying your first post-CARM Release 2 shipments by 2-3 weeks, costing you valuable sales during peak seasons.
The Evolution of CARM: From Release 1 to Full Implementation
CARM's rollout has been phased, with each stage introducing new capabilities and compliance demands:
- CARM Release 0 (January 2021): Internal CBSA system upgrades. Largely invisible to importers.
- CARM Release 1 (May 2021): Launched the CARM Client Portal (CCP), allowing importers to register, view transaction histories, and delegate access to customs brokers. This was the foundational step for direct engagement with CBSA.
- CARM Release 2 (October 2024, now May 2026): The game-changing phase. This release introduces the Commercial Accounting Declaration (CAD), replaces the previous B3 and B2 forms, enables self-assessment and payment directly through the CCP, and mandates the requirement for financial security (surety bonds) for all importers wishing to take advantage of the Release Prior to Payment (RPP) privilege.
The May 2026 deadline for CARM Release 2 is critical. After this date, any importer without an active surety bond or sufficient cash deposit will lose their RPP privilege, meaning duties and taxes must be paid before goods are released from customs. For e-commerce, where rapid fulfillment is paramount, this is an unacceptable bottleneck.
Core Compliance Pillars for Cross-Border E-commerce Under CARM
To ensure uninterrupted flow of goods into the Canadian market, e-commerce businesses must master these CARM compliance pillars:
1. CARM Client Portal (CCP) Registration and Account Management
The CCP is your primary interface with the CBSA. Every non-resident importer (NRI) requires a unique Business Number (BN9) and associated import/export program account (RM extension, e.g., 123456789RM0001). If you don't have one, you must apply to the Canada Revenue Agency (CRA).
Actionable Step: Register your business on the CARM Client Portal immediately. This involves linking your business to your personal GCKey or Sign-in Partner account. Ensure that the legal entity registering is the ultimate consignee (importer of record) for customs purposes. Many e-commerce businesses operate under various legal structures; confirming the correct entity for the BN9 is crucial to avoid future discrepancies.
2. Delegating Authority to Your Customs Broker
Under CARM, the relationship with your customs broker evolves. While they remain essential for declaration filing, the financial liability for duties and taxes shifts directly to the importer. You must formally delegate authority to your customs broker within the CCP, granting them the necessary permissions to manage your customs transactions, file CADs, and access your account data.
Key Insight: Previously, many brokers extended their own RPP privileges to importers. CARM eliminates this. Your broker can still facilitate your RPP, but the underlying financial security must be yours. This is a crucial distinction that often surprises importers.
3. Financial Security: The Mandate for Surety Bonds
This is arguably the most significant change for e-commerce under CARM Release 2. To maintain the RPP privilege—allowing your goods to be released before duties and taxes are paid—you must post financial security with the CBSA. For most e-commerce importers, this means obtaining a surety bond.
- Bond Amount: The bond must cover 50% of your highest monthly accounts receivable with the CBSA over the previous 12-month period, with a minimum of $25,000 CAD and a maximum of $10 million CAD.
- Cost: Surety bond premiums typically range from 1-3% of the bond amount annually, depending on your company's financial health. For an e-commerce brand with $200,000 in monthly duties/taxes, this could mean a $100,000 bond, costing $1,000-$3,000 per year.
- Alternatives: While cash deposits are an option, they tie up capital inefficiently and are rarely practical for e-commerce operations.
Counterintuitive Insight: Many e-commerce businesses assume their customs broker will simply handle the bond, as they have historically managed RPP. However, under CARM, the bond is in the importer's name and for their direct liability. Relying on a broker's bond past May 2026 is not an option. Proactively securing your own bond can save you thousands in expedited fees and prevent significant shipping delays during the final months before the deadline when bond providers will be overwhelmed.
💡 Expert Tip: Initiate your surety bond application at least 6 months prior to the May 2026 deadline. The underwriting process can take 4-6 weeks, and capacity from bond providers will tighten significantly as the deadline approaches. Securing your bond early can save you up to 15% on premium costs by avoiding last-minute surcharges.
4. Commercial Accounting Declaration (CAD) & Data Accuracy
The CAD replaces the antiquated B3 form. It requires precise data, including:
- Accurate HS Code Lookup: Correct classification of goods is paramount for determining applicable duties, taxes, and regulatory requirements. Errors can lead to overpayment, underpayment, and CBSA penalties. Our HS code lookup guide can assist in this critical step.
- Country of Origin: Affects preferential tariff treatments (e.g., CUSMA/USMCA).
- Valuation: The transaction value of goods, freight, and insurance must be accurately reported.
- Taxes: GST/HST, PST, QST as applicable.
For e-commerce, high transaction volumes necessitate automated solutions for data accuracy. Relying on manual classification for hundreds or thousands of SKUs is unsustainable and prone to errors that could trigger CBSA audits, potentially resulting in fines of $1,000-$25,000 per infraction under the Administrative Monetary Penalty System (AMPS).
5. Self-Assessment and Payment
CARM empowers importers to self-assess and directly pay duties and taxes through the CCP. This provides greater transparency and control but also places the onus of accuracy squarely on the importer. Payment cycles will be standardized, typically due on the 10th business day of the month following the period of release.
Benefit: Direct payment gives e-commerce businesses a clearer picture of their cross border ecommerce tax liabilities and can improve cash flow management by preventing delays associated with broker-managed payments.
6. Adjustments and Disputes
CARM streamlines the process for making adjustments to past declarations (replacing the B2 form). If an error is identified, importers or their delegated brokers can submit adjustments through the CCP. This enhanced visibility and control over post-release corrections can reduce the time and cost associated with rectifying errors, potentially saving hundreds of dollars per adjustment compared to previous manual processes.
Why DutyPilot vs. Competitors: Bridging the CARM Compliance Gap
Many existing solutions in the market, while useful for specific functions, fall short in providing the holistic, actionable compliance framework demanded by CARM.
| Feature/Service | DutyPilot | Avalara/TaxJar | Zonos/SimplyDuty | Customs Info/Pirate Ship |
|---|---|---|---|---|
| CARM 2026 Direct Compliance Focus | ✅ Comprehensive guides, portal integration advice, bond strategy. | ❌ Primarily US sales tax, limited CARM depth. | ❌ Checkout only, minimal compliance guides. | ❌ Data/shipping focus, not compliance strategy. |
| HS Code Lookup & Automation | ✅ Advanced AI-powered classification, Canadian-specific tariffs. | ✅ Available, but often global/US-centric. | ✅ Basic lookup, less automation. | ✅ Data available, but not integrated compliance. |
| Landed Cost Calculation Accuracy | ✅ Real-time, all-inclusive, Canadian tax & duty specific. | ✅ Good, but can lack Canadian nuance. | ✅ Good, but often estimates. | ❌ Limited, shipping focused. |
| Financial Security (Bond) Guidance | ✅ Detailed advice, broker network referrals. | ❌ Not a core offering. | ❌ Not offered. | ❌ Not offered. |
| Self-Assessment & Payment Support | ✅ Integration advice, process walkthroughs. | ❌ Not a focus. | ❌ Not a focus. | ❌ Not a focus. |
| Cost-Benefit for Importers | 🎯 Reduces risk by 30-40%, potential 10-15% duty savings. | 📉 Moderate, primarily sales tax. | 📈 Limited to checkout optimization. | ↔️ Data access, not savings. |
While companies like Avalara and TaxJar excel in U.S. sales tax compliance, their resources for Canadian import duties and the intricacies of CARM are often less robust. Zonos provides excellent landed cost calculation and checkout integration, but its compliance guidance typically stops at the point of sale, leaving the importer to navigate the post-importation CARM requirements independently. SimplyDuty offers an effective import duty calculator, but lacks the deep dives into specific regulatory frameworks like CARM that are critical for ongoing compliance. Finally, services like Customs Info provide vast datasets, but without the strategic application to CARM for e-commerce. Pirate Ship is a shipping solution, not a customs compliance platform.
DutyPilot fills this void by offering not just an advanced landed cost calculation engine, but also comprehensive, actionable guides that directly address the Canadian CARM ecosystem, empowering non-resident importers to navigate the new landscape with confidence and precision. We focus on providing the specific insights and tools needed to manage your cross border ecommerce tax obligations effectively, ensuring you meet CBSA requirements proactively rather than reactively.
The Strategic Advantage for E-commerce in a CARM World
Embracing CARM isn't merely about compliance; it's an opportunity for strategic advantage. By taking direct control of your import process:
- Enhanced Data Accuracy: Direct access to your import data via the CCP allows for better tracking of HS codes, valuation, and duties paid, leading to more accurate landed cost calculations and financial forecasting. This can reduce duty overpayments by 5-8% annually.
- Improved Cash Flow: Managing your own RPP and payment schedule allows for better liquidity management, avoiding unexpected broker-related fees or delays.
- Reduced Audit Risk: Proactive compliance, accurate data, and proper financial security significantly reduce the likelihood of CBSA audits and associated penalties. A well-managed CARM profile can reduce audit risk by up to 34%.
- Faster Clearance: Maintaining RPP with your own surety bond ensures seamless customs clearance, minimizing transit delays that can cost an e-commerce business hundreds or thousands of dollars per day in lost sales and customer dissatisfaction.
The transition to CARM is a significant undertaking, but the rewards for those who prepare diligently are substantial. It’s an investment in the long-term efficiency and legality of your Canadian e-commerce operations.
💡 Expert Tip: Conduct a comprehensive review of your current HS code classifications. Many e-commerce businesses find 10-15% of their SKUs are misclassified, leading to either overpayment of duties or underpayment and subsequent penalties. Investing in a professional HS code audit now can save your business thousands of dollars in future adjustments and fines underpayment interest.
Frequently Asked Questions About CARM 2026 for E-commerce
What is Canada's CARM System?
Canada's CARM (CBSA Assessment and Revenue Management) system is a multi-year initiative by the Canada Border Services Agency (CBSA) to modernize the collection and assessment of duties and taxes for commercial imports. Full implementation by May 2026 shifts financial liability directly to importers, requiring them to manage their accounts, post financial security, and self-assess duties via the CARM Client Portal, impacting over 280,000 active importers.
How will CARM 2026 impact non-resident e-commerce importers?
CARM 2026 will profoundly impact non-resident e-commerce importers by requiring them to register on the CARM Client Portal, obtain their own surety bond (or cash deposit) to maintain Release Prior to Payment (RPP) privileges, and take direct responsibility for self-assessing and paying duties and taxes. Without a bond, goods could be held at the border until payment is received, potentially delaying shipments by 3-5 days and increasing operational costs by 15-20%.
Why is a surety bond mandatory under CARM Release 2?
A surety bond is mandatory under CARM Release 2 for any importer wishing to continue benefiting from the Release Prior to Payment (RPP) privilege. This bond acts as financial security, guaranteeing the CBSA that outstanding duties and taxes will be paid, even if the importer defaults. It covers 50% of the importer's highest monthly accounts receivable with a minimum of $25,000, ensuring the government's revenue stream is protected.
Can my customs broker handle my CARM compliance?
While your customs broker remains crucial for filing Commercial Accounting Declarations (CADs) and advising on compliance, CARM shifts the ultimate financial liability for duties and taxes directly to the importer. You must register on the CARM Client Portal, obtain your own financial security (surety bond), and formally delegate authority to your broker. Brokers can no longer extend their own RPP privileges to you after May 2026, meaning your direct involvement is non-negotiable.
What are the risks of non-compliance with CARM 2026?
The risks of non-compliance with CARM 2026 are substantial, including loss of Release Prior to Payment (RPP) privileges, leading to goods being held at the border until duties are paid, causing significant delays and inventory backlogs. Importers also face administrative monetary penalties (AMPS) ranging from $1,000 to $25,000 per infraction for incorrect declarations, and potential interest charges on overdue payments, severely impacting profitability and customer satisfaction.
Should I use an import duty calculator for CARM compliance?
Yes, utilizing a robust import duty calculator is highly recommended for CARM compliance, particularly for e-commerce. Tools like DutyPilot's landed cost calculator can help accurately estimate duties, taxes, and fees, ensuring correct valuation for Commercial Accounting Declarations (CADs). This proactive calculation reduces errors, improves landed cost accuracy by up to 15%, and helps prevent underpayments or overpayments that could trigger CBSA scrutiny or penalties.
Action Checklist: Do This Monday Morning for CARM 2026 Readiness
- Verify Your BN9 and RM Account: Log into the CARM Client Portal (CCP) or apply for a Business Number (BN9) with the CRA if you don't have one. Ensure your import/export (RM) program account is active and correctly linked. This is foundational.
- Initiate Surety Bond Assessment: Contact a reputable surety provider or your customs broker for a quote on a CARM financial security bond. Understand the required bond amount based on your historical import data and begin the application process.
- Review Your HS Code Strategy: Audit your top 50-100 SKUs for accurate Harmonized System (HS) code classification. Utilize an advanced HS code lookup tool to identify potential discrepancies that could lead to penalties under the new CAD system.
- Delegate Authority to Your Broker: If you haven't already, formally delegate access to your customs broker within the CARM Client Portal. Confirm they have the necessary permissions to manage your CADs post-Release 2.
- Assess Internal Data Systems: Evaluate how your current e-commerce platform and ERP systems capture and transmit customs data (e.g., valuation, country of origin). Identify gaps that will require automation or integration to support accurate CAD filing.
- Budget for CARM Compliance: Allocate budget for potential surety bond premiums (expect 1-3% of the bond value annually), software upgrades, and any professional consulting required to ensure a smooth transition.
Global freight forwarding and supply chain platform
Frequently Asked Questions
What is Canada's CARM System?
Canada's CARM (CBSA Assessment and Revenue Management) system is a multi-year initiative by the Canada Border Services Agency (CBSA) to modernize the collection and assessment of duties and taxes for commercial imports. Full implementation by May 2026 shifts financial liability directly to importers, requiring them to manage their accounts, post financial security, and self-assess duties via the CARM Client Portal, impacting over 280,000 active importers.
How will CARM 2026 impact non-resident e-commerce importers?
CARM 2026 will profoundly impact non-resident e-commerce importers by requiring them to register on the CARM Client Portal, obtain their own surety bond (or cash deposit) to maintain Release Prior to Payment (RPP) privileges, and take direct responsibility for self-assessing and paying duties and taxes. Without a bond, goods could be held at the border until payment is received, potentially delaying shipments by 3-5 days and increasing operational costs by 15-20%.
Why is a surety bond mandatory under CARM Release 2?
A surety bond is mandatory under CARM Release 2 for any importer wishing to continue benefiting from the Release Prior to Payment (RPP) privilege. This bond acts as financial security, guaranteeing the CBSA that outstanding duties and taxes will be paid, even if the importer defaults. It covers 50% of the importer's highest monthly accounts receivable with a minimum of $25,000, ensuring the government's revenue stream is protected.
Can my customs broker handle my CARM compliance?
While your customs broker remains crucial for filing Commercial Accounting Declarations (CADs) and advising on compliance, CARM shifts the ultimate financial liability for duties and taxes directly to the importer. You must register on the CARM Client Portal, obtain your own financial security (surety bond), and formally delegate authority to your broker. Brokers can no longer extend their own RPP privileges to you after May 2026, meaning your direct involvement is non-negotiable.
What are the risks of non-compliance with CARM 2026?
The risks of non-compliance with CARM 2026 are substantial, including loss of Release Prior to Payment (RPP) privileges, leading to goods being held at the border until duties are paid, causing significant delays and inventory backlogs. Importers also face administrative monetary penalties (AMPS) ranging from $1,000 to $25,000 per infraction for incorrect declarations, and potential interest charges on overdue payments, severely impacting profitability and customer satisfaction.
Should I use an import duty calculator for CARM compliance?
Yes, utilizing a robust import duty calculator is highly recommended for CARM compliance, particularly for e-commerce. Tools like DutyPilot's landed cost calculator can help accurately estimate duties, taxes, and fees, ensuring correct valuation for Commercial Accounting Declarations (CADs). This proactive calculation reduces errors, improves landed cost accuracy by up to 15%, and helps prevent underpayments or overpayments that could trigger CBSA scrutiny or penalties.
Found this helpful? Share it with your network.
📋 Disclosure: DutyPilot may earn a referral commission through our partner links. Our trade compliance content is produced independently.
DutyPilot